Taxonomic Classification

Rank chainfruit Key lime
Kingdom same Plantae (Plants) Plantae (Plants)
Phylum same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ants)
Class same Magnoliopsida (Dicots) Magnoliopsida (Dicots)
Order Gentianales (Gentianales) Sapindales (Sapindales)
Family Apocynaceae Rutaceae
Genus Alyxia Citrus
Species Alyxia ilicifolia Citrus aurantiifolia

Evolutionary Relationship

chainfruit and Key lime share a common ancestor at the Class level: Magnoliopsida. (Dicots)
